Recreation Aide – Part Time – $18.13/hr
Under the general supervision of the Recreation Supervisor, the employee assists in the scheduling and conducting of recreational and athletic activities. Responsibilities include registering new members, reserving courts, operating and maintaining the pro shop, and supporting youth programs. Work is reviewed through observation for adherence to established policies and procedures.
Responsibilities
Open and close recreation and park facilities as needed
Take reservations and maintain inventory of supplies and equipment
Operate the front desk, sell accessories, rent equipment, and issue membership cards
Answer inquiries by phone and in person, providing information on facilities and services
Ensure facilities are kept neat and clean; verify equipment is safe and in working condition
Collect monies from guests for recreational and facility activities and maintain accurate records
Assist with Special Events and activities
Qualifications
High School Diploma or GED
Valid State of Florida driver’s license
Prior recreation experience preferred
